Torbageddon, the Second Edition in Rome for Whisky Lovers

The second edition of Torbageddon returns to Rome on Sunday, November 17, 2024. This edition is packed with exciting new features, starting with five high-level masterclasses.

The masterclasses include an exclusive pre-opening by Springbank, featuring a fascinating sequence of five batches of the 12-year-old full-proof whisky. Another masterclass showcases five expressions of peated whiskies from the Rinaldi distribution, and the final, no less significant, masterclass presents a Laphroaig vertical hosted by Stock Italia, the Italian importer, featuring two aged rarities of 30 and 33 years.

Velier will be the main sponsor of the 2024 edition. In addition to offering bottles for tasting from its portfolio, it will host two masterclasses: one on the Japanese whisky giant Nikka and another on the Highland Park distillery from the Orkney Islands.

The tasting table will feature over 200 primarily peated whiskies from around the world (another new addition this year is an increase in available labels). It will open at 2:00 PM and close at 10:00 PM, with tastings available via tokens for 2 cl portions.

The Torbageddon event, aimed primarily at enthusiasts of so-called peated whiskies, is part of the initiatives by Spirits Lab, a group represented by Igor and Diego Malaspina of Whisky Italy, Matteo Cervini from the White Rabbit bar, Arnaldo Maggiora Vergano and Lorenzo Giovannetti from the YouTube channel and association Non Solo Whisky, and finally, Pino Perrone, wine and spirits writer and former organizer of the Rome Whisky Festival.

This 2024 edition also introduces a new location, easily accessible for those arriving from outside Rome or using public transport.
